This simple melody is Poland’s best known Christmas lullaby. It was even adapted by Chopin and incorporated into his Scherzo No. 1 in B minor (op. 20) as a subsidiary theme. In Polish it is called Lulajże, Jezuniu, a lullaby for the baby Jesus. Gwyn Arch arranged the Christmas carol in an English text version for four male voices a cappella.
